THE REGULARITIES OF QUEUES IN MODELS WITH INFINITE WAITING ROOM
AbstractIn the present paper the developments of Queueing Theory is described, its belongness to Operations Research and Probability Theory is substantiated. The Regularities of Many Servers Queues with infinite waiting room are explained on the example of $GI|G|s|\infty$ model. The explicit formulas, limit theorems in c, stability, inequalities for the main characteristics, extremal problems are presented. The main attention in future is given to $GI|G|s|\infty$ model with FIFO service discipline. Not only known results are formulated, but also some results, which were established by authors. For instance, in $GI|G|s|\infty$ model two groups of assumptions are suggested, which lead to the Little formulas. In particular, $M|G|s|\infty$ model is considered.

INITIAL BOUNDARY VALUE PROBLEM FOR SOBOLEV TYPE NONLINEAR EQUATIONS
AbstractIn this paper following initial boundary value problem is considered: $$\begin{cases} A\left(\dfrac{\partial u}{\partial t}\right)+Bu=f, \\ u(0)=u_0, \\D^{\gamma}|_{\Gamma}=0, |\gamma|\leq m. \end{cases}$$ Operators $A$ and $B$ are nonlinear and have the following form: $$Au=\displaystyle\sum_{|\alpha|\leq m}(-1)^{|\alpha|}D^{\alpha}A_{\alpha}(x, t, D^{\gamma}u), ~~Bu=\displaystyle\sum_{|\alpha|\leq m}(-1)^{|\alpha|}D^{\alpha}B_{\alpha}(x, t, D^{\gamma}u), |\gamma|\leq m. $$
Conditions for functions $A_{\alpha}$ and $B_{\alpha}$ are obtained that lead to existence and uniqueness of solution of the problem in the spaces $L^p(0, T, ^0W^m_p), p\geq 2$.

ALGEBRAIC MULTIGRID PRECONDITIONER FOR ELLIPTIC PROBLEMS WITH MIXED TYPE BOUNDARY CONDITIONS II. MULTIGRID PRECONDITIONER
AbstractThe present paper, consisting of two parts, is devoted to constructing algebraic multigrid preconditioners for stiffness matrices arising in finite element approximation of elliptic problems in rectangular domains. The Dirichlet condition is placed on one part of the boundary and third type condition on the rest of the boundary. In the second part, using a sequence of two-grid preconditioners from [1], the multigrid preconditioner with inner Chebyshev iterations is constructed.

THE STABILITY OF SOLUTION OF PURSUIT-EVASION TO SEVERAL GOAL SETS GAME PROBLEM FOR SYSTEMS WITH VARYING DYNAMICS
AbstractConditions are obtained by which the solutions in the case of several goal sets and the systems with varying dynamics are stable with respect to informational disturbance. The stability of solution of pursuit-evasion to m goal sets game problem is analyzed when the object follows a system of nonlinear nonstationary differential equations with varying dynamics. So the dynamic of the system is changing step by step. The sequence of meetings with the goal sets is fixed. The moments of systems switching are assumed to be constant values. A family of u-stable bridges is constructed. A piecewise positional strategy extremal to that family and the theorem about the solution's stability with respect to informational disturbance of the pursuit-evasion to one goal set game problem, proved by N.N. Krasovskii, are applied. Conditions are obtained by which the solutions are stable with respect to informational disturbance.

SOME CORRECTIONS FOR THE RESIDUAL NUCLEI FORMATION CROSS SECTIONS AT THE IRRADIATION OF TIN ISOTOPES BY THE $^{12}$C IONS AT THE ENERGY 2.2 $GeB$/NUCLEON
AbstractThe presence of constant flux of particles falling on the target is presupposed while determining the yields of residual nuclei by the induced activity method. However in reality the beam of particles possesses fluctuation. In the present work these fluctuations were considered when determining the intensity of the beam of particles. In some cases the corrections of the fluctuations are of about 30%.

DISLOCATION DENSITY INFLUENCE ON MOIRE PATTERN FORMATION
AbstractIn the given work it is theoretically and experimentally stated that the decrease of dislocation density in a crystalline block of X-ray interferometer leads to the decrease of the frequency of moire fringes.
